Output 506856703b33df34980d833f9e7773ef2f85fe3334b80a0c328fd95b54a990da:44

value
223596
script pubkey
OP_0 OP_PUSHBYTES_32 9b8efddaeaae858e9bba818fbf65d5f28e50396b1426cd8de98c91eafb0efe82
address
bc1qnw80mkh246zcaxa6sx8m7ew47289qwttzsnvmr0f3jg747cwl6pqzj9znl
transaction
506856703b33df34980d833f9e7773ef2f85fe3334b80a0c328fd95b54a990da
confirmations
127017
spent
true